opportunity for all of our Healthcare Pros. INDWELLSPAN Position
Overview: The purpose of this position is to perform a variety of
imaging procedures, including CT and X-Rays, at a technical level
not requiring constant supervision. Essential Job Functions: -
Provide technical assistance and supportive patient care to assist
the physicians, nurses and other technical and administrative staff
in meeting the needs of individual patients throughout the
facility. - Operate and maintain all imaging department equipment
including but not limited to X-Ray, CT, CR reader, and PACS -
Perform all imaging exams in accordance with established policies,
procedures, regulations, and laws and ensure the physician on duty
is notified of the results - Perform basic clinical procedures
under the direction of the physician and/or nurse on duty -
Maintain all required documentation, logs, charts, forms and
records in paper and electronic formats - Collect laboratory
samples and perform lab testing in accordance with established
policies and procedures, as well as COLA and CLIA regulations -
Maintain an adequate supply of all reagents and consumables to
perform quality testing - Perform all routine daily, weekly,
monthly, and periodic maintenance and function checks following
established protocol for all imaging equipment - Perform Quality
Control as established by this laboratory - Perform Proficiency
Testing and/or Split Sample analysis periodically as established by
this facility - Retain records of all analytic activities performed
for a minimum of two years - Perform all Quality Assessment
activities assigned to this position and document these activities
for periodic review by the Laboratory Supervisor and/or the
Laboratory Director Other Job Functions: - Perform duties as ER
Technician as needed - Maintain an adequate supply of all reagents
and consumables to perform quality testing - Perform all routine
daily, weekly, monthly, and periodic maintenance and function
checks following established protocol for all imaging equipment -
Travel to all facility locations as required - Attend staff
meetings or other company sponsored or mandated meetings as
required - Perform additional duties as assigned Basic
Qualifications: - High School diploma or GED, required - Graduation
from an AMA-approved school of Radiology Technology, required -
Associate’s Degree in Radiology, preferred - Certified as a medical
radiologic technologist as required by the state in which
practicing, required - Registered Technologist with the American
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) in radiography required
- Registered Technologist with the American Registry of Radiologic
Technologists (ARRT) in computed tomography, preferred - CT
certification required within 12 months of hire (Pennsylvania
market) - Current BLS certification through the American Heart
Association, required - 2 years radiologic/imaging experience,
preferred - 1 years of CT experience, preferred - 1 years of
emergency room experience, preferred - Proficiency with most
X-ray/CT equipment, manufacturer’s hardware/software and PACS -
Position requires fluency in English; written and oral
communication
